If your boiler's on the way out or your central heating system needs attention, you need a Central Heating Engineer in Beverley who understands the particular demands of the town's mix of historic properties and modern estates. Beverley's Georgian townhouses and Victorian terraces along Norwood and the Walkington Road require specialist knowledge of older systems, while the post-war housing around Leconfield and newer developments demand expertise with contemporary combi boilers and smart controls. Whether you're dealing with a frozen pipe in a January freeze or planning an upgrade before winter sets in, a qualified heating engineer in Beverley serves not only the town itself but the surrounding villages—Walkington, Lockington, Kilham—where properties often depend on reliable heating systems. The Humber region's unpredictable weather makes a well-maintained boiler and heating network essential for local families and property investors alike.

Running a Central Heating Engineer Business in Beverley
Beverley's Victorian and Edwardian properties—many with original cast-iron radiators and outdated systems—create constant demand for heating upgrades and fault diagnosis. The town serves as a hub for engineers covering Walkington, Thearne, and the expanding residential estates toward Dunswell. With the Minster's heating demands, period properties, and new-build developments needing commissioning, there's steady work year-round, particularly during autumn and winter months when boiler breakdowns spike.
